This is a bit of a problem. We've done a lot of work to set up Carvalho as a PC. And now, less than an hour into the player's first session, he's had his guts blown out. However. Carvalho was with the marine group that was exposed to the black oil. I had been thinking the oil might give him a version of the Second Wind talent. So, I decided to go with that. I let Carvalho make a stamina check. He makes it. And the definitely-should-be-dead marine rises to his feet (with exploded bits of his bowels still dangling from the wound).

* I've scaled back the UPP soldier and insurgent stats a bit. 3 in STR and AGI. UPP soldiers have range combat 3 and 4 armor. Insurgents get range combat 1 (no armor). 

* I've had Wright die of her chestburster off-screen. Part of that is because I want to just run this as a traditional firefight. And now the insurgents and a UPP officer have seen an alien worm burst from a marine's chest. They will be curious about this...
